The Scientific Shock: Unexplained ‘Ghost Lineages’ in Human DNA
Here is where the hard science gets incredibly interesting. When geneticists mapped the human genome, they expected to find a clean, predictable line of descent. Instead, they found a complicated, tangled bush of ancestry. We already know that modern humans carrying non-African ancestry have about 1% to 2% Neanderthal DNA. People of Melanesian and Indigenous Australian descent carry up to 4% to 6% Denisovan DNA. But recently, scientists discovered something else: a ‘ghost lineage’ in populations from West Africa and other regions.
A ghost lineage is a term scientists use when they find a set of genetic markers in modern humans that clearly came from a distinct, separate hominid species—but we have absolutely no fossil record of that species. It is a ghost in our code. In some West African populations, up to 19% of their genetic makeup comes from this mysterious, unknown ancestor. Separating Mainstream Genetics from Radical Theories
As much as I love exploring these theories, it is vital to keep our feet on the ground and look at what mainstream science actually says. When geneticists discover a Ghost Lineage in Human DNA, they do not immediately jump to biblical giants. Instead, they look for logical, evolutionary explanations. They hypothesize that ancient Africa, Europe, and Asia were once home to dozens of different hominid species that lived alongside early humans, occasionally interbreeding before dying out.
According to mainstream science, the idea of Nephilim DNA is a misinterpretation of these natural, complex evolutionary processes. Scientists point out that ancient human migration, isolated geographic pockets, and natural genetic mutations are more than enough to explain the unexplained gaps in our genome. They argue that calling a ghost lineage ‘Nephilim DNA’ is simply putting a mythological label on a standard, albeit mysterious, evolutionary occurrence.
